- Antonio Lexerot was born on May 15, 1974 in March Air Force Base, California, USA. He is an actor and director, known for Keepsake (2018), He Knows When You've Been Bad (2018) and Surge of Power: Revenge of the Sequel (2016).

- Made his first movie in 1989 at age 14 with his neighbor using a VHS camcorder. There is no known surviving copy of "Philadelphia Pete and his Last Crude Days.".
- Had skull crushed and was nearly killed at age three and still bears the scar visible on the left side of his forehead.
- Received Outstanding Thespian Award 1992 from the International Thespian Society.
- Was the 1991-1992 Oylmpus High School Drama Club President in Holladay, Utah.
- After his picture appeared in the article titled "Bela Lugosi Is Not Dead" in the October 26, 1995 edition of the University of Utah newspaper, The Daily Utah Chronicle, he was contacted by Rolling Stone Magazine. They requested photographs for an article they were planning. The article never came to fruition, but they were happy with the photos.
